Crosstown Plaza is a large strip mall in Schenectady, NY (at the Rotterdam-Schenectady line[1]) along Watt Street and NY State Route 7 near the I-890 entrance. As of January, 1991, the strip mall consisted of 183,500 square feet.[1] By August, 1995, it was 193,500 square feet.[2]

Tenants

[edit]

Over the years, tenants have included:

Tenant Name Opening Date
Caldor before 1979 (closed January, 1999) (85,000 sq. ft.)[3]
Red Cross Blood Donor Center 1985[4]
Spa Lady before July 25, 1986[5][6]
Champion Factory Outlet before May 10, 1990[7] (closed by December 31, 2004[7])
American Cancer Society before May, 1993[8]
Nutri/System Inc. before May, 1993 (closed at that point, reopened August 9, 1993)[9]
BuyerSmart unknown, closed late 1993/early 1994[10]
Price Chopper before 1995[11] (closed this location March, 2002[12])
Old Country Buffet (free-standing building) between 1994 and 1995April 29, 1999[13][2] (closed November 17, 2008[14]
P.T. Barnum's Magical Emporium before December, 1995[15]
Fabric Bonanza before March, 1997[16]
Fay's Drugs unknown [17] (store name changed to Eckerd's as of April 21, 1997)[18]
WOW Family Amusement Center before April 29, 1999[19]
Ames July 20, 2000[20] (closed October 19, 2002[21])
Tuesday Morning September, 2000[22]
King Cork Wine & Liquors before February, 2002[23]
PriceRite October 16, 2002[24]
Household Finance after October 23, 2004[25]
Sears Hardware before May, 2006[25]
Ocean State Job Lot before March 10, 2007[26] (expansion plans[27])

Considered as a DMV location

[edit]

In mid-1990, Schenectady County considered moving a DMV office in either Crosstown Plaza, Mohawk Mall, or Rotterdam Square Mall.[28] However, the county legislature ultimately decided against the move. If moved, annual rent at Crosstown Plaza would have cost $29,640.[29]

Ownership

[edit]

As of July, 1990, Crosstown Plaza was owned by Wade Lupe Construction Company, a developer in Schenectady County.[29][1] By April, 1994, the construction company's name was Hexam Gardens Construction Company.[13]
